Table des matières
Yunohost
Instalation
Ici on se limite à une installation sur un vps. Il faut obligatoirement le système debian 10
Il faut un accés root sur le serveur en ssh
curl https://install.yunohost.org | bash
Deuxième étape
Avant de lancer cette deuxième étape il faut connaitre le nom de domaine de votre yunohost
yunohost tools postinstall
Attention à la fin l'utilisateur root ne fonctionnera plus avec ssh mais il faudra utiliser admin
Applications qui marchent
- Pleroma –> installation plante
- mastodon –> installation ok
- Friendica Comment installer Friendica avec Yunohost
Application à installer
* Etherpad
- rainloop –> Je ne l'utilise pas : Est ce que je garde ?
- funkwhale –> a planté à la mise à jour. Il va falloir réinstaller.
Applications que je voudrais tester et qui ne marchent pas
- Hubzilla : installation ok mais page blanche il manquait mstring
- Movim : installation plante
ligne de commande
Yunohost ne marche pas bien avec l'interface graphique. La ligne de commande souvent fonctionne mieux
yunohost app [install,remove, upgrade] application
For #Pleroma logs:
$ sudo journalctl -feu pleroma
For #nginx logs: $ tail -n 100 /var/log/nginx/domain.tld-error.log
Mise à jour
yunohost app upgrade peertube
Ne pas afficher le bouton yunohost
Méthode 1
sudo su yunohost settings set ssowat.panel_overlay.enabled -v False
Cette méthode n'avais pas l'air de fonctionner. Peut être car je n'avais pas supprimer les cookies. Méthode 2
cd /etc/nginx/conf.d admin@the:/etc/nginx/conf.d $ sudo mv yunohost_panel.conf.inc yunohost_panel.conf.inc.bak admin@the:/etc/nginx/conf.d $ sudo touch yunohost_panel.conf.inc
Ne pas oublier de supprimer les cookies pour que cela soit pris en compte
Sauvegarde
Sauvegarder une application
yunohost backup create --apps peertube
Restauration
yunohost backup restore <nom_d'archive>